About this role

A Graduate Program Assistant (Programming GA) position supporting the DC Reads program at American University. The role is for enrolled AU graduate students and contributes to the university’s Center for Leadership & Community Engagement to advance educational access and community-engaged literacy and mentorship initiatives connecting K–8 youth with students.

About American University

american.edu

American University is a private research university located in Washington, D.C. It offers a diverse range of undergraduate and graduate programs across various disciplines, emphasizing a commitment to liberal arts education and public service. The university is known for its engaged learning opportunities in politics, international relations, business, and the arts, fostering a community that encourages diversity, critical thinking, and civic engagement. With a vibrant campus culture, American University promotes innovative teaching and learning strategies to prepare students for successful careers and responsible citizenship.
